SEATTLE, Sept. 2, 2014 /PRNewswire/ — Alaska Airlines launched daily round-trip service today between Seattle and Baltimore. To celebrate, the airline is offering introductory one-way fares of $169 for tickets purchased by Sept. 8 for travel from Oct. 21 through Nov. 19, 2014.

"We're delighted to be adding another great city to our list of nonstop flights available to our Seattle-area customers," said Joe Sprague, senior vice president of communications and external relations for Alaska Airlines. "SeattleBaltimore is a great complement to our existing service to Reagan Washington National Airport from our West Coast hubs of Seattle, Los Angeles and Portland, Oregon."

With the new Baltimore flight, coupled with the airline's Detroit service starting Sept. 4 and Albuquerque service starting Sept. 18, Alaska Airlines will offer 273 peak-day departures to 78 destinations from Seattle, more than three times that of any other airline.
